If you know the gender of your recipient, use “Dear” followed by a person’s title (Mr., Ms.) and their last name: If you know only a full name, use it without a title. Instead of “Mrs.,” always use “Ms.” If a woman has a professional title — Dr., Prof., Officer, etc., choose it instead. Many letter salutations are appropriate for business and employment-related correspondence, including: Follow the greeting with a colon or comma, then use a line break and start the first paragraph of your letter.
